What is the Recovery Rebate Credit and how does it work?
The third stimulus payment was an advance payment of the 2021 Recovery Rebate Credit. If you did not receive a third stimulus payment check or an amount less than you were eligible for, you could claim the Recovery Rebate Credit on your 2021 tax return. What Are Estimated Tax Payments?
IRS expects taxes to be paid on income as it is earned, referred to as the pay-as-you-go system. Therefore, individuals with income that isn’t subject to withholding taxes make estimated tax payments to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) every quarter.
